Commercial Cabinetry Project Manager/Estimator
4 weeks ago
We are seeking a highly skilled and detail-oriented individual to join our team as a Commercial Cabinetry Project Manager/Estimator. In this role, you will be responsible for managing and estimating cabinetry projects for various commercial buildings, including hospitals, retirement homes, clinics, and other facilities. You will be tasked with interpreting drawings, developing take-offs, and accurately quoting all applicable millwork. The ideal candidate will have a strong background in cabinetry, excellent project management skills, and a keen eye for detail.
Responsibilities:
Interpretation of Drawings: Analyze architectural drawings and specifications to understand project requirements and scope.
Take-Off Development: Develop detailed take-offs from drawings, identifying all necessary materials, dimensions, and specifications for cabinetry projects.
Estimation: Utilize take-offs to accurately estimate costs for materials, labor, and other project expenses.
Project Management: Coordinate with internal teams, subcontractors, and clients to ensure timely completion of projects within budget and according to specifications.
Supplier Management: Source and negotiate with suppliers to obtain competitive pricing for materials and services required for cabinetry projects.
Budgeting: Assist in the development of project budgets and monitor expenditures to ensure adherence to financial targets.
Quality Control: Implement quality control measures to ensure that all cabinetry meets industry standards and client expectations.
Documentation: Maintain accurate records, including project plans, schedules, change orders, and other relevant documentation.
Communication: Act as the primary point of contact for clients and stakeholders, providing regular updates on project progress and addressing any concerns or issues that arise.
Team Leadership: Provide leadership and guidance to project teams, fostering a collaborative and efficient work environment.
Qualifications:
- Bachelor's degree in Construction Management, Architecture, or a related field (preferred).
- Proven experience in cabinetry, millwork, or construction estimating.
- Strong proficiency in reading and interpreting architectural drawings and specifications.
- Excellent mathematical skills and attention to detail.
- Advanced knowledge of estimating software and Microsoft Office Suite.
- Effective communication and negotiation skills.
- Ability to multitask and prioritize in a fast-paced environment.
- Project management certification (e.g., PMP) is a plus.
